A Tale of Tragedy and Christian Forgiveness

Credit :

The opioid epidemic is delivering tragedy and pain to families across the country. Here's how one such family has responded in Christ.

On Jan. 30, 2016, Ashlynn Bailey, a 20-year-old from Pelham, Alabama, died from a drug overdose.

As John and I have said on BreakPoint many times, America is in the midst of an opioid epidemic — one that kills more people every year than the AIDS epidemic of the 1980s and '90s.
